WINSTON-SALEM -- Police are investigating the shooting deaths of two people at a house in Winston-Salem.
Police say John K. Gallaher III, 24, is charged with two counts of murder in the deaths of Sean Bert Gallagher, 23, of Rural Hall and Lori Fioravanti, 24, of Pfafftown.
Capt. David Clayton told the Winston-Salem Journal that officers were trying to figure out what happened.
Police said Gallaher met officers outside the house after calling 911 early Tuesday morning.
Gallaher's family would not talk about his arrest Tuesday. He had his first court appearance Wednesday and said he had hired an attorney.
Sean Gallagher's family would not talk with reporters.
Fioravanti's sister, Gina Gougler, told the newspaper the family has gotten no explanation for the shootings.
